Cardiovascular & Metabolic

The primary cause of death globally is attributed to cardiovascular and metabolic diseases, accounting for approximately 30 percent of all fatalities. Cardiovascular diseases involve disorders affecting the heart and blood vessels, while metabolic diseases pertain to disorders affecting the body's chemical processes involved in metabolism.

Hormones & Menopause

Hormonal imbalances could be responsible for a variety of undesirable symptoms, ranging from fatigue or weight gain to itchy skin or low mood. Hormones, which are chemicals produced by glands in the endocrine system, are released into the bloodstream. An imbalance occurs when there is an excess or deficiency of a particular hormone.

Autoimmune Diseases

An autoimmune disorder arises when the immune system exhibits an abnormal response to a functioning part of the body. Certain autoimmune diseases have a familial tendency, and some cases may be initiated by infections or other environmental factors. The number of identified autoimmune diseases exceeds 100.

Chronic Illnesses

A health condition that persists for one year or longer, demanding continuous medical attention or restricting daily activities or both, is categorized as a chronic illness. Leading causes of death and disability in the United States include chronic diseases such as heart disease, cancer, and diabetes.

Unexplained Symptoms

Medically unexplained physical symptoms (MUPS or MUS) refer to symptoms for which treating physicians or healthcare providers have identified no discernible medical cause or whose cause is still a matter of dispute. Approximately 15% to 30% of all primary care consultations are estimated to be related to medically unexplained symptoms.

Gastrointestinal

Identifying the root cause of numerous gastrointestinal (GI) tract symptoms can be challenging. Nevertheless, it is feasible to prevent and/or treat the majority of gastrointestinal diseases. Certain symptoms associated with GI issues, such as GERD, abdominal pain, bloating, and IBS, may persist even in the absence of other underlying problems. Conversely, other types of GI disorders are defined by both symptoms and observable irregularities.

Mental Health

A moderate level of stress is a typical aspect of daily life. Small amounts of stress can assist individuals in meeting deadlines, preparing for presentations, staying productive, and ensuring punctuality for important events. However, when stress becomes persistent and overwhelming, it can pose risks to both mental and physical well-being. Extended periods of stress elevate the likelihood of mental health issues, including anxiety and depression. Additionally, it can contribute to problems such as substance use, sleep disturbances, and physical complaints like muscle tension and pain.
